How to Choose the Right Portable Water Dispenser for Your Pet

Size and Capacity Considerations

Selecting the right capacity is crucial for your pet’s hydration needs. Water dispensers typically range from 12 to 64 ounces, with smaller capacities sufficient for small breeds during short outings. For larger dogs or extended trips, opt for at least 20 ounces to minimize refill frequency. Consider your pet’s daily water intake and the availability of refill stations at your destination when determining the ideal size.

Material and Durability Factors

Food-grade materials free of BPA and phthalates should be your priority when choosing a pet water dispenser. Silicone and fabric options offer lightweight portability and collapsibility, while plastic and stainless steel provide superior durability for active pets. The MalsiPree uses food-grade plastic that’s sturdy yet lightweight, while the Leashboss features food-safe silicone that resists punctures. For pets that tend to chew or play roughly with their accessories, invest in more robust materials.

Ease of Use Features

Look for dispensers with intuitive dispensing mechanisms that allow one-handed operation. The MalsiPree’s button-activated system that recycles unused water offers excellent conservation, while splash-free designs like the Leashboss with its broad lip prevent messy spills during car travel. Portability features such as carabiners, foldable designs, or attachment loops enhance convenience during hikes or walks. Consider cleaning requirements as well—some models require hand washing while others offer dishwasher-safe components for easier maintenance between adventures.

Tips for Maintaining and Cleaning Your Pet’s Portable Water Dispenser

1. Regular Cleaning

Regular cleaning of your pet’s portable water dispenser is essential to prevent bacterial growth. Hand wash the bottle and bowl components with mild soap and warm water after each use. For silicone parts, pay special attention to folds and crevices where residue can hide. Most premium dispensers like the MalsiPree Dog Water Bottle require hand washing as they’re not dishwasher compatible.

2. Dishwasher Safety

Always check manufacturer guidelines before placing your pet’s water dispenser in the dishwasher. Many portable dispensers, including the MalsiPree Dog Water Bottle and PetLibro Dockstream App Monitoring Water Fountain, are not dishwasher safe. Improper cleaning methods can damage seals and mechanisms, leading to leaks or premature wear. If dishwasher-safe, place small components in a utensil basket to prevent loss.

3. Filter Maintenance

If your portable dispenser features a filtration system, replace filters according to the manufacturer’s schedule. The PetLibro Dockstream fountain, for example, requires regular filter changes to maintain water quality. Mark filter replacement dates on your calendar to ensure your pet always has clean, fresh-tasting water. Neglected filters can harbor bacteria and affect your pet’s willingness to drink.

4. Dry Thoroughly

After cleaning, thoroughly dry all components of your pet’s water dispenser before reassembly. Use a clean microfiber cloth to reach small spaces and remove all moisture. Proper drying prevents water spots, mold growth, and extends the life of your dispenser. For hard-to-reach areas, consider using compressed air to ensure complete dryness.

5. Inspect for Leaks

Regularly examine your pet’s water dispenser for signs of damage, cracks, or seal deterioration. Test the dispensing mechanism to ensure proper function and check for leaks by filling with water and inverting. Pay particular attention to threaded connections and silicone seals where leaks commonly develop. Addressing minor issues early prevents water waste and keeps your pet properly hydrated during travel.

6. Storage

When not in use, store your pet’s portable water dispenser disassembled and completely dry. For silicone components, avoid stacking heavy items on top to prevent deformation. Keep bottles and dispensers in a cool, dry place away from direct sunlight to prevent plastic degradation. Proper storage ensures your dispenser remains hygienic and ready for your next adventure with your pet.

What size water dispenser should I get for my pet?

Choose based on your pet’s size and trip duration. Small pets (under 20 lbs) typically need 12-20 oz dispensers, medium pets (20-50 lbs) require 20-40 oz options, and large pets (over 50 lbs) need 40-64 oz capacity. For short outings, smaller containers work fine, but opt for larger capacities for extended trips to ensure adequate hydration throughout the day.

Which materials are best for portable pet water dispensers?

Look for food-grade, BPA-free materials like silicone and stainless steel. Silicone options are lightweight and collapsible, making them ideal for travel. Stainless steel provides durability and temperature regulation. For active pets, select dispensers with reinforced construction that can withstand rough handling. Avoid low-quality plastics that might affect water taste or contain harmful chemicals.

How often should I clean my pet’s water dispenser?

Clean your pet’s water dispenser after each use to prevent bacterial growth. For daily use, rinse thoroughly at the end of each day and perform a deep cleaning with mild dish soap 2-3 times per week. Always check manufacturer guidelines for dishwasher safety. If your dispenser has filters, follow the recommended replacement schedule, typically every 2-4 weeks.

Are portable water dispensers suitable for all pets?

Most portable water dispensers work well for dogs and cats, but pet-specific features may enhance usability. Consider your pet’s drinking habits—some prefer lapping from bowls while others do better with bottle-style dispensers. For brachycephalic breeds (flat-faced dogs), wider dispensing areas provide easier access. Senior pets may need dispensers that require minimal effort to activate water flow.

How do I get my pet used to a portable water dispenser?

Introduce the dispenser at home before traveling. Let your pet explore it while empty, then add water and demonstrate how it works. Use positive reinforcement with treats when they drink from it. Some pets may need time to adjust—be patient and consistent. Maintain your pet’s regular water routine alongside the new dispenser until they’re comfortable using it independently.
